Re: HANZO - The Ultimate Dreamcast VGA BOX wuth Scanlines

Post by HydrogLox »

beharius wrote:I will also build a scart addon for them, however I am not sure if all TVs can accept comp. sync (h+v sync combined)
Just put a big fat orange sticker with a warning on the male Euro-SCART connector to only use the cable on inputs that support both 15kHz AND 31kHz RGBS. A lot of XRGB-mini owners would want that cable as they are already using SCART switches to support multiple retro-consoles and use an Euro-SCART to MiniDIN-8 adapter to connect to the XRGB-Mini (which supports 31kHz on its RGBS input).
beharius wrote:For American customers, I will build RGBHV to BNC RGBS cables too.
You may want to find out if there is actual demand for that configuration. It is my impression that 15 kHz RGB never went "mainstream" with consumer electronics in North America. Extron RGB interfaces which can output RGBS on (female) BNC seem to have mostly been used in institutional settings on displays in lecture halls and meeting rooms. So when there is any 15 kHz RGB support to begin with, there typically isn't a real "standard" for the connector used. For example, in a recent discussion I discovered that the DVDO iScan VP30 supports 31kHz RGBHV on the BNC inputs while 15 kHz RGBS support is piggybacked on the RCA connectors for component video :roll:. So unless you want to offer custom cables, NA customers may just have to replace the SCART connector themselves with the connectors they need.

Re: HANZO - The Ultimate Dreamcast VGA BOX wuth Scanlines

Post by Ganelon »

beharius wrote:For games not supporting VGA, the switch tricks the system first by booting in RGB mode and then to VGA.
Can you provide some more information on this switch? For games that don't natively output 480p, is the signal 480i or 240p (before being converted to 480p)? A more concrete example would be: how do Super Street Fighter II X and Vampire Chronicle for Matching Service appear on the Hanzo? When you force a 240p display, they normally only show the top-left corner of the picture.

Post by beharius »

This trick may not be compatible with all games. Some games are patched for VGA mode.
You can read this faq
http://www.gamefaqs.com/dreamcast/91641 ... /faqs/2674
Or the Hanzo Manual for more info:
http://anten.com.tr/content_files/banne ... manual.pdf

Boot it in RGB 15KHZ mode until you hear a beeping sound, then change the switch to VGA 31khz mode.

Actually Capcom games look crappy, edgy, pixelated (whatever you prefer to call) on a hi res VGA monitor, because of their low res graphics , but when you apply the Scanliner function, they look awesome!
"I wasn't playing these games for years, Dreamcast was never my system of choice for playing those fighting games until I discovered scanlines. I was missing the old days with my Sony CRT. Now I can’t stop playing them on my Panasonic plasma monitor."

I tried a backup copy of SSF2X, and it's perfect on the VGA mode with scanlines, it may be a patched one.
I haven't tried the Vampire Chronicles, but I know some games may not work on the VGA mode, but playing it in 15khz RGB still better than the official scart cable or other types of cables.
